Abstract

OBJECTIVE

The objective of this study was to characterize the diffusion of methodological innovation.

STUDY DESIGN AND SETTING

Comparative case study analysis of the diffusion of two methods that summarize confounder information into a single score: disease risk score (DRS) and high-dimensional propensity score (hdPS). We completed systematic searches to identify DRS and hdPS papers in the field of pharmacoepidemiology through to the end of 2013, plotted the number of papers and unique authors over time, and created sociograms and animations to visualize co-authorship networks. First and last author affiliations were used to ascribe institutional contributions to each paper and network.

RESULTS

We identified 43 DRS papers by 153 authors since 1981, reflecting slow uptake during initial periods of uncertainty and broader diffusion since 2001 linked to early adopters from Vanderbilt. We identified 44 hdPS papers by 147 authors since 2009, reflecting rapid and integrated diffusion, likely facilitated by opinion leaders, early presentation at conferences, easily accessible statistical code, and improvement in funding. Most contributions (87% DRS, 96% hdPS) were from North America.

CONCLUSION

When proposing new methods, authors are encouraged to consider innovation attributes and early evaluation to improve knowledge translation of their innovations for integration into practice, and we provide recommendations for consideration.

摘要

目的

本研究旨在描述方法学创新的传播特征。

研究设计与背景

对两种将混杂因素信息汇总为单一分数的方法(疾病风险评分[DRS]和高维倾向评分[hdPS])的传播进行比较案例研究分析。我们进行了系统检索,以识别截至2013年底药物流行病学领域的DRS和hdPS相关论文,绘制了论文数量和独特作者数量随时间的变化图,并创建了社会关系图和动画以可视化共同作者网络。第一作者和最后作者的所属机构被用于确定每篇论文和网络的机构贡献。

结果

自1981年以来,我们共识别出153位作者撰写的43篇DRS相关论文,这反映出在不确定性的初始阶段采用速度较慢,而自2001年以来,由于范德比尔特大学的早期采用者,传播范围更广。自2009年以来,我们共识别出147位作者撰写的44篇hdPS相关论文,这反映出其快速且综合的传播,可能得益于意见领袖、在会议上的早期展示、易于获取的统计代码以及资金的改善。大多数贡献(DRS为87%,hdPS为96%)来自北美。

结论

在提出新方法时,鼓励作者考虑创新属性和早期评估,以提高其创新的知识转化,使其能够融入实践,我们提供了一些建议供参考。
